Line segment QP is tangent to the circle.

A circle is shown. Secant M P and tangent Q P intersect at point P outside of the circle. Secant M P intersects the circle at point N. The length of Q P is n, the length of N P is 11.5, and the length of M N is 24.

What is the length of line segment QP? Round to the nearest unit.

13 units
17 units
18 units
20 units

Use the tangent-secant theorem: (tangent)^2 = (external secant segment) × (whole secant).

External segment = NP = 11.5. Whole secant = NP + MN = 11.5 + 24 = 35.5.

n^2 = 11.5 × 35.5 = 408.25, so n = √408.25 ≈ 20.21, which rounds to 20.

Answer: 20 units.
